Mrs. Ellington, Terry County pioneer, discusses the county’s history and her life there.

General Interview Information

Interviewee Name: Mrs. F. M. Ellington

Additional Parties Recorded:

Date: August 3, 1972

Location: Brownfield, Texas

Interviewer: Kathryn Hamilton

Length: 25 minutes


Abstract

Tape 1, Side 1: Moved to Texas for her health, Trip to brother's home by wagon described, Discusses life in Harris community, Harris Store recalled, Church meetings characterized, Taught in a one-room school, Meeting with future husband recounted, Husband filed on land in 1906, Was a cowboy and horse breaker, Describes parties given at their first home, States impressions of West Texas' terrain, Brandings recalled, Wildlife in early days discussed, Rattlesnakes a particular problem, Children named, Husband was formerly sheriff of Terry County, 1920s, Changes seen through the years reviewed

Tape 1, Side 2: Blank

Range Dates: 1906-1920s

Bulk Dates: 1906-1920s
